Silver Hero Scindapsus - Eye-Catching Foliage That Shimmers
Scindapsus pictus 'Silver Hero' is a new hero plant of our shop, and we can't stop staring at it. The foliage of the 'Silver Hero' has a fabulous shimmer of silver, that reminds us of the glaze on a fabulous donut. Give the 'Silver Hero' a trellis or moss pole to climb up and it will reach skyward indefinitely. As the foliage of the 'Silver Hero' mature, the depth of the silver foliage becomes richer and more pronounced.

Plant Profile
- Botanical Name: Scindapsus pictus 'Silver Hero'
- Common Name: Silver Hero Scindapsus
- Family: Araceae
- Native Range: Southeast Asia
How to care for Silver Hero Scindapsus
- Care Level: Easy
- Light: Prefers bright to medium indirect light. Direct sunlight will scorch its leaves, and too-little light will result in slow growth and the leaves to lose variegation.
- Water: Water thoroughly and allow the top 1-2in of soil dry out between watering. The plant will let you know it's thirsty when the foliage begins to droop. Water less frequently in winter.
- Humidity: 40-60%
- Temperature: 60-85F. Avoid cold drafts.
- Pruning: Prune as needed to remove brown or dead leaves.
- Feeding: Fertilize monthly during spring and summer with water-soluble fertilizer diluted by half.
- Propagation: Stem Cuttings
- Growth: Trails 3 ft or more
- Common Pests: Mostly resilient to pests
- Toxicity: Toxic to humans and pets
